Teacher Unions to ballot for industrial action on vaccines


Posted by SchoolDays Newshound, on 07/04/2021. Teacher Unions to ballot for industrial action on vaccinesTags: Teachers Parenting


All three Teacher Unions, (INTO, ASTI and TUI) have today agreed to ballot for industrial action, including strike action, if the government does not meet their demands to reverse the recent changes to the priority listing for teachers within the vaccination programme.

The teachers unions are giving the Government until the summer break to put teachers back on the vaccine priority list. However the Unions are also demanding early vaccination  within the overall cohort of education staff of pregnant teachers, those in higher risk categories and those who work in special schools, special classes and home school community liaison teachers.

Yesterday, Education Minister says that the decision to shift to an age-based vaccine roll-out is “not a value judgement on any given profession, it is simply science”.
